摘要
We describe temperature sensing by hollow core fibers using whispering gallery modes of a spherical microresonator. Light from a tunable laser was coupled into the input end of the hollow core fiber. Optical resonances were excited in a microsphere inserted in the modified output end. Part of the light was coupled back from the resonator into the hollow core fiber and transported back to the input end. This light was recorded via a beam splitter by a diode. The sensing principle is based on the shift of the optical resonances by changing the temperature of the resonator. This shift is monitored and leads to the temperature of the resonator and surrounding respectively.
